The ultimate goal of residents at George Daly House is to obtain permanent housing. This reflects a fundamental objective in many housing and social service programs, where the focus is on transitioning individuals from temporary or unstable living situations to a stable, secure home environment. Attaining permanent housing not only addresses the immediate need for shelter but also lays the groundwork for residents to improve other aspects of their lives, such as employment and financial independence.

While aiming for employment, long-term shelters, or financial independence are valuable goals, they usually stem from or are facilitated by having a stable place to live. Ensuring that residents have permanent housing is oftentimes the cornerstone of effective integration into the community and enhances overall wellbeing.
